Understanding Software Video Compression
In the fast-paced digital era, the need for efficient storage and transmission of video content is paramount. Software video compression refers to the process of reducing the file size of digital video files without significantly compromising their quality. This technique is essential for streaming, storage, and sharing, as video files can be large and unwieldy.

Applications of Software Video Compression
Software video compression has wide-ranging applications across various sectors. Some key areas include:
- Streaming Services: Platforms like Netflix and YouTube rely heavily on video compression to deliver high-quality content over the internet without buffering.
- Video Conferencing: Tools such as Zoom and Skype use compression algorithms to facilitate smooth video calls even with limited bandwidth.
- Social Media: Platforms like Facebook and Instagram employ video compression to ensure quick uploads and downloads while maintaining an adequate viewer experience.
- Video Editing: Editors use compression to manage file sizes, enabling easier handling of multiple video files without significant quality loss.
